Address

DF37rhkKfcj1jaDqxp6bxfJmqJRa958q4n

0 DGB

Confirmed
Total Received 2141404.22317679 DGB14598.81 USD
Total Sent 2141404.22317679 DGB14598.81 USD
Final Balance 0 DGB0.00 USD
No. Transactions 2

Transactions

DF37rhkKfcj1jaDqxp6bxfJmqJRa958q4n 2141404.22317679 DGB14598.81 USD14598.81 USD
 
DUHLTA8yNtabAsXhi4nfAXQjo3n1E7nL2S 2021504.72077468 DGB13781.41 USD13781.41 USD
DMRPvHgXuy3agx8pmN7fwPUQrGYkeUw9bP 119899.50014211 DGB817.40 USD817.40 USD
DNR9UHbEaAd8aULe6XWcMXbAMRdRgdST8F 2145955.18503953 DGB14629.83 USD14629.83 USD
 
D9dvcV2FgnrNjyVqDSb7FiEvWEUsNde1S4 4550.95960274 DGB31.03 USD31.03 USD
DF37rhkKfcj1jaDqxp6bxfJmqJRa958q4n 2141404.22317679 DGB14598.81 USD14598.81 USD